Started getting this error regularly tonight, was online with VZW and Samsung all night. Verizon said it was Samsung, Samsung said Verizon. Power Cycled, took battery out, but it in, cleared app cache, cleared app data, did a cache wipe as well. Nothing. It works once, maybe twice, then stops and I get the no network connection again. Anyone else?

FIXED.  In my case, I had accidentally turned off the "Sync" switch under the notification bar. Turning it back on enabled S-Drive to communicate with its server again. The "no network connection" error message is a little misleading; this had nothing to do with my 4g data connection, which was fine.
